Bapu Bazar is one of the oldest and best markets to shop in Jaipur. With an availability of myriad of Rajasthani products, the place is best to buy souvenir or memorabilia to capture the moments of your days in Jaipur. Mojari shoes, camel leather products, handicrafts, textiles, marble and sandstone carvings are some of the typical products of this market.

The Bazaar lies in the heart of the city, on MI Road.
